The Bishop Watterson Eagles will venture away from home to take on the Olentangy Braves at 5:00 p.m. on Wednesday. The teams are on pretty different trajectories at the moment (Bishop Watterson has nine straight wins, Olentangy has three straight losses), but none of that matters once you're on the field.
It was a Battle of the Birds when Bishop Watterson duked it out with Big Walnut on Monday. The Eagles came out on top against the Golden Eagles by a score of 5-2.
Max Steinbrunner sp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: he surrendered just two earned runs on five hits.

At the plate, the team relied heavily on Caden Mangini, who went a perfect 3-for-3 with one home run, four RBI, and two runs. That's the most hits he has posted since back in April. Ben Burleson was another key player, getting on base in two of his three plate appearances with one stolen base and one run.
Meanwhile, Olentangy scored first but ultimately less than Hayes in their contest on Thursday. They fell just short of the Pacers by a score of 8-7.
Bishop Watterson's victory bumped their record up to 22-3. As for Olentangy, their defeat dropped their record down to 13-11.
